Peter Stella on the Feds Off-Balance Sheet Transactions and Public Financing of the COVID-19 Crisis

Published: June 8, 2020, 6:12 a.m.

Peter Stella is a former IMF official, where he led the Central Banking and Monetary and Foreign Exchange divisions, and he now hosts a webpage titled *Central Bank Archeology*. Peter is also a former guest of Macro Musings, and rejoins to talk about the COVID-19 crisis, central bank balance sheets, and more. David and Peter also discuss the dangers and challenges of the Fed\u2019s off-balance sheet transactions, how the government should approach crisis financing, and who should be managing the country\u2019s public debt.
